What is Tune.fm?
Tune.fm is a music streaming platform that allows artists to monetize their music directly through JAM Token, a native cryptocurrency of the platform. Unlike traditional services like Spotify or Apple Music, Tune.fm empowers musicians by giving them greater control over their earnings and allowing listeners to directly reward their favorite artists.
The platform is designed to be accessible to both independent artists and listeners who want to discover new music while financially supporting creators.
Key Features
- Monetization via JAM Tokens
Listeners can purchase JAM Tokens (Tune.fm’s cryptocurrency) and use them to reward artists for every play of their songs.
Artists receive 90% of the revenue generated by their plays, which is significantly higher than the payout rates of traditional platforms like Spotify (which pays around $0.003-$0.005 per stream). - Cryptocurrency Integration
Tune.fm uses blockchain technology to ensure transparent payments and reduce intermediaries.
Users can exchange JAM Tokens for other cryptocurrencies or withdraw them to their digital wallets. - Ease of Publishing Music
Artists can upload their music directly to the platform without the need for intermediary distributors.
The platform supports various audio formats and metadata, making it easier to organize and promote tracks. - Music Discovery
Tune.fm offers search tools and personalized recommendations to help listeners discover new artists.
Users can explore specific genres, curated playlists, and emerging content. - Community and Direct Support
Listeners can follow their favorite artists and receive notifications when they release new music.
The relationship between artists and fans is closer, as listeners have a direct impact on the creators’ earnings.

Disadvantages of Tune.fm
- Limited Adoption
Although Tune.fm has an innovative concept, it still doesn’t have the same user base as platforms like Spotify or YouTube. This may limit the initial exposure of your music. - Dependence on Cryptocurrencies
The use of JAM Tokens may be a barrier for some users unfamiliar with cryptocurrencies or blockchain.
Fluctuations in cryptocurrency values could affect the income received. - Less Marketing and Visibility
Unlike established platforms, Tune.fm doesn’t invest heavily in marketing. This means artists must actively promote their music to attract listeners. - Features Still in Development
While the platform has interesting features, some functionalities are still under development and may not be as robust as those on more established platforms.
